Description

Kamco is a rapidly growing manufacturer that has recently been acquired by private investors, so this is a very exciting time to be joining a company that has a 40-year-old heritage and exciting growth plans.


This is a fantastic opportunity for anyone looking to develop their buying career and step into a role that offers career development.

As a member of the Kamco team you will oversee and complete purchases of materials, supplies, and contracted services. You will also be responsible for commercial negotiations and evaluation of current and new suppliers.


Essential Duties & Responsibilities
Ø Review stock levels and requirements to plan purchases.

Ø Work with production to find solutions to material shortage.

Ø Manage material requirements by working closely with the Factory Manager and Sales lead.

Ø Request quotations for, raise orders for and book in stock items, consumables, and raw materials.

Ø Maintain product, order, and supplier data.

Ø Ensure timely deliveries and resolution of discrepancies through communication with suppliers.

Ø Negotiate with suppliers on product pricing and delivery terms.

Ø Build, maintain and manage supplier relationships.

Ø Evaluate alternative materials and suppliers; negotiating pricing and terms where applicable.

Ø Provide analysis on costings and supplier performance.

Ø Identify new suppliers through benchmarking and product evaluation.

Ø Liaising with logistic suppliers to manage Export requirements.

Ø Provide monthly updates to the Managing Director & Finance Director

Ø Occasional support within the sales team at exhibitions and or events.
